PRST 5500 - Foundations of Leadership

Institution:
Austin Peay State University
Subject:
RODP Professional Studies
Description:
Prerequisite: Admission to the MPS Program or Departmental approval;Description: Students study leadership from a historical and contemporary perspective. Topics cover historical development, leadership theories, personal assessment, values and ethics, motivation, power, fellowship, group dynamics, diversity, controversy with civility, change process, and citizenship.
